They have a product called Organicide at Home Depot that works great. I used it once on plants that had webs they were so infested, and they are all gone. It is the only product I have found that works on the eggs.
I mixed like 1oz of Organicide, like 1oz neem oil, and a splash of dish soap, in 1gal of water, and wiped all my leaves with this mix. I rubber gloves and just dipped my fingers in the solution and rubbed all the leaf surfaces, keeping it off the buds. This stuff stinks so do it outside.
You may want to try like 1/2oz of each product the first time as some strains don't like it as much as others and drop some fan leaves. This is the best treatment for mites that I have found. You can also flood your room with Co2 during the dark period. Get it up to like 30,000 ppm of Co2 in your room, and this will help kill the adults, but not the eggs. Like I said, that Organicide is made to kill the eggs as well so it is the best product I can recomend.
